Output 63b4f383e5ea52da2e02d03475bb3f52e9de8bce4e93d1d7da4ca24d82a8bb5e:1

value
853126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e48e0821c0854415dba431bd99c3a288ae20deb OP_EQUALVERIFY OP_CHECKSIG
address
15DjPQYUoTtu9NQjEKXWqsecMobH1z9d2C
transaction
63b4f383e5ea52da2e02d03475bb3f52e9de8bce4e93d1d7da4ca24d82a8bb5e
confirmations
238977
spent
true